Summary

First Citizens BancShares, Inc. /DE/ (FCNCA) announced on June 26, 2025, the appointment of Diane Morais to its Board of Directors, effective July 1, 2025. Ms. Morais brings extensive experience in consumer and commercial banking, digital transformation, and risk management, having held senior leadership positions at Ally Bank and Bank of America. Her appointment is expected to enhance the Board's expertise in key strategic areas, including technology and risk oversight, given her proven track record in driving growth and innovation within the financial services sector. Key Highlights

  • 1Appointment of Diane Morais to the Board of Directors, effective July 1, 2025.
  • 2Ms. Morais brings over 15 years of leadership experience from Ally Bank, where she served as President of Consumer and Commercial Banking.
  • 3Her background includes significant roles at Bank of America and Citibank, with expertise in deposits, digital banking, credit cards, and customer experience.
  • 4Ms. Morais has been appointed to serve on the Board's Risk Committee and Technology Committee.
  • 5The Board has determined Ms. Morais is an "independent" director under Nasdaq listing requirements.
  • 6Ms. Morais has a distinguished career, recognized by American Banker Magazine and the Charlotte Business Journal for her achievements in banking and business.
  • 7No related-party transactions requiring disclosure under Item 404(a) of Regulation S-K were noted.
